From 5d0b276e70f9b15582d2771068c27e975b2abdfe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E9=99=88=E6=B2=85?= <907037276@qq.com> Date: Wed, 21 Jun 2023 10:59:35 +0800 Subject: [PATCH] =?UTF-8?q?maven=E6=89=93=E5=8C=85=E5=BC=82=E5=B8=B8?= =?UTF-8?q?=E5=A4=84=E7=90=86=20token=E8=8E=B7=E5=8F=96=E6=96=B9=E5=BC=8F?= =?UTF-8?q?=E4=BF=AE=E6=94=B9?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- pom.xml | 25 +++++++++++++++++++ .../annotation/aspect/OperateLogAspect.java | 3 ++- src/main/resources/application-test.yml | 8 ++++++ 3 files changed, 35 insertions(+), 1 deletion(-) diff --git a/pom.xml b/pom.xml index ae5860d..058f802 100644 --- a/pom.xml +++ b/pom.xml @@ -113,7 +113,21 @@ + foreignExchangeTrading + + org.springframework.boot + spring-boot-maven-plugin + + + + repackage + + + + + + org.apache.maven.plugins maven-surefire-plugin @@ -126,6 +140,17 @@ org.springframework.boot spring-boot-maven-plugin + + + org.apache.maven.plugins + maven-resources-plugin + + + @ + + false + + diff --git a/src/main/java/com/sztzjy/forex/trading_trading/annotation/aspect/OperateLogAspect.java b/src/main/java/com/sztzjy/forex/trading_trading/annotation/aspect/OperateLogAspect.java index 1852e39..5d9ef65 100644 --- a/src/main/java/com/sztzjy/forex/trading_trading/annotation/aspect/OperateLogAspect.java +++ b/src/main/java/com/sztzjy/forex/trading_trading/annotation/aspect/OperateLogAspect.java @@ -4,6 +4,7 @@ import cn.hutool.core.util.URLUtil; import cn.hutool.extra.servlet.ServletUtil; import cn.hutool.http.HttpUtil; import com.sztzjy.forex.trading_trading.annotation.OperateLog; +import com.sztzjy.forex.trading_trading.config.Constant; import com.sztzjy.forex.trading_trading.config.LogRecordEvent; import com.sztzjy.forex.trading_trading.config.SpringContextHolder; import com.sztzjy.forex.trading_trading.config.security.JwtUser; @@ -55,7 +56,7 @@ public class OperateLogAspect implements Ordered { Log logRecord = new Log(); JwtUser curUser = null; try { - String token = request.getHeader("token"); + String token = request.getHeader(Constant.AUTHORIZATION); curUser = TokenProvider.getJWTUser(token); } catch (Exception e) { logRecord.setOperatorName("匿名"); diff --git a/src/main/resources/application-test.yml b/src/main/resources/application-test.yml index e69de29..6ec8785 100644 --- a/src/main/resources/application-test.yml +++ b/src/main/resources/application-test.yml @@ -0,0 +1,8 @@ +spring: + datasource: + druid: + db-type: mysql + url: jdbc:mysql://${DB_HOST:localhost}:${DB_PORT:3306}/${DB_NAME:foreign_exchange_trading}?useSSL=false&serverTimezone=UTC + username: ${DB_USER:root} + password: ${DB_PWD:sztzjy2017} + driver-class-name: com.mysql.cj.jdbc.Driver \ No newline at end of file